Wither peers out from behind the strange object, studying New Arethor from behind her mask. Looking both left and right she turns, satisfied that no one else is around.

She cautiously makes her way towards Noble, pausing several times at the sounds of monsters in the night, before ignoring the noises and continuing on her path. She curls up beneath a tree for the remaining part of the night, only partially sleeping to ensure no monsters or people get the upper hand if they attack her. When the morning sun rises, Wither gets back up and yawns, stretching several times before making her way toward the Shield's barracks. She steps into the bushes, trying to blend in as she studies the surrounding area for any nearby people.

Seeing none, she steps out of the bushes, brushing the leaves and other things off of her clothes. Walking carefree, but remaining quiet as possible, she makes her way around the building. Peering toward the makeshift throne room she smiles as she notes that no one is there. Wither steps into the wooden 'palace', double checking the area just outside of it before entering further. She studies the throne for several moments before climbing on it. Glancing down at her battle claws she smirks beneath her mask. Reaching her right hand up, she turns toward the back of the throne and rakes the claws attached to her glove across the back, leaving faint scratches down the throne. Wither repeats this action several times before she is content that the marks are deep enough.

Climbing off of the throne, Wither looks at her claw work for a moment, wishing it were a bit deeper. Shrugging, she decides that she has spent too much time there already and jumps down. The outside of the throne room is still empty when she checks and so Wither simply walks away, the claw marks the only proof she was there.
